Chelsea are willing to sell Alejandro Garnacho, according to reports, with the Argentine set to leave Stamford Bridge after just one season. The former Manchester United winger struggled to impress following his £40 million transfer last year and The Blues will only consider a permanent move.

Football London claims: ”There is interest in Garnacho and there have been reports in Italy regarding Roma wanting to loan the winger, but Chelsea, sources say, will only consider a permanent transfer this summer.
”Garnacho, whose contract at the Bridge does not expire until 2032, made 43 appearances in his debut season in west London but failed to cement a regular spot in the starting XI under all three head coaches.
”While there are potential suitors for Garnacho, there have been no club-to-club talks over the former United winger yet.”

Man Utd’s Ederson deal still going ahead
Manchester United remain confident a deal for Ederson will go through after denying rumours the £39m move is set to fall through, the Daily Mail reports.
United sources told the Mail that the structure of the deal and personal terms are agreed, and they will complete the move later this month after the player’s late call-up to Brazil’s World Cup squad.
The Mail adds: ”Ederson, who turns 27 on Tuesday, is believed to have had an initial medical check, but United say they will put him through a full medical now Brazil’s participation in the World Cup is over. Carlo Ancelotti's side were dumped out by Norway at the last-16 stage on Sunday night, Erling Haaland scoring twice in a 2-1 win.
”United were delighted to reach agreement with Atalanta at the start of June to pay £35million plus £3.8m in add-ons for Ederson.
”However, they have been frustrated in their attempts to add up to two more midfielders to their squad since then, losing out to Manchester City and Tottenham for Elliot Anderson and Mateus Fernandes respectively.”
Villa duo set for contract talks
Ezri Konsa and Pau Torres are set to hold contract talks with Aston Villa this summer, the Daily Mail reports.
Konsa and Torres are the club’s first-choice centre-back pairing who both have two years left on their current contracts.
The Mail adds: ”Villa are currently walking a tightrope to stay within UEFA spending rules. European football chiefs have effectively ruled that Villa cannot add significant players to their squad without making a sale first – so it could make more sense for them to improve deals for existing players than to trade.
”If Villa opted to cash in on Konsa or Torres, they would demand a high price to fund a replacement of similar quality. Konsa is 28 and Torres 29 – meaning many clubs would think twice before paying a huge fee for either.
”Konsa is currently on duty with England at the World Cup and played in their 3-2 win over Mexico in the early hours of Monday, while Torres was not included in the Spain squad.”
